摘要:
1、登录MySQL服务器,查看慢查询日志是否开启 命令: mysql> show variables like '%slow_query_log%'; + + + | Variable_name | Value | + + + | slow_query_log | OFF | | slow_quer 阅读全文
摘要:
十大原则: 1.全值匹配我最爱2.最佳左前缀法则3.不在索引列上做任何操作(计算、函数、(自动or手动)类型转换),会导致索引失效而转向全表扫描4.存储引擎不能使用索引中范围条件右边的列5.尽量使用覆盖索引(只访问索引的查询(索引列和查询列一致), 减少select *6. mysql在使用不等于( 阅读全文
摘要:
For example ==> Eight Case: 1、主键自动建立唯一索引 2、频繁作为查询条件的字段应该建立索引 3、查询中与其它表关联的字段,外键关系建立索引 4、频繁更新的字段不适合建立索引,因为每次更新不单单只更新的记录,还要更新索引(即当建立索引的列上的数据发生改变时,要时时刻刻维护 阅读全文
摘要:
type类型 从最好到最差依次是: system > const > eq_ref > ref > range > index > all 对以上分类的详细介绍表格如下: type类型 详细介绍 system 表只有一行记录(等于系统表),这是const类型的特例,平时不不会出现,这个可以忽略不计 阅读全文
摘要:
题目描述 给定一个长度为 n 的数组 v1,v2,…,vn。 初始时,数组中的所有元素都为 0。 接下来,可以对该数组进行若干次如下操作 对于第 i次操作(i 从 0开始),你可以: 要么选择其中一个元素 vpos,将其增加 ki。 要么不选择任何元素,直接跳过此次操作。 你可以随时停止操作(不进行 阅读全文
摘要:
一、设置网络模式为桥接模式 在虚拟机的虚拟网络编辑器中将桥接的外部网络设置为自己本机已联网的网卡即可 然后进入以下界面(这里我选择真实网卡,也就是最后一个) 二、修改文件 1、DHCP(动态主机分配协议) 命令: vim /etc/sysconfig/network-scripts/ifcfg-en 阅读全文
摘要:
注入属性时,对象的属性值为null的写法 <!-- null值 --><bean id="对象名" class="全限定类名"> <property name="属性名"> <null/> </property> </bean> 注入属性时,对象的属性值包含特殊符号的写法 <!-- 属性值包含特殊符 阅读全文
摘要:
第一步 去mysql官网下载mysql5.5.48的rpm安装包,网址 第二步 将下载好的两个rpm文件从自己电脑拖动到linux中的/opt文件夹下(我这里就是在虚拟机中安装的linux系统),如下所示: 这里我们如果不能直接将两个安装包拖到opt目录下,也可使用命令的方式移动进去,放入之后,在l 阅读全文